But we ourselves will go ready armed before the children of Israel, until we have brought them unto their place: and our little ones shall dwell in the fenced cities because of the inhabitants of the land.
Numbers 32:29-32
29
"If the men of Gad and Reuben cross the Jordan ready for battle at the LORD's command and if with their help you are able to conquer the land, then give them the land of Gilead as their property.
30
But if they do not cross the Jordan and go into battle with you, they are to receive their share of the property in the land of Canaan, as you do."
31
The men of Gad and Reuben answered, "Sir, we will do as the LORD has commanded.
32
Under his command we will cross into the land of Canaan and go into battle, so that we can retain our property here east of the Jordan."
Deuteronomy 3:18-20
18
"At the same time, I gave them the following instructions: 'The LORD our God has given you this land east of the Jordan to occupy. Now arm your fighting men and send them across the Jordan ahead of the other tribes of Israel, to help them occupy their land.
19
Only your wives, children, and livestock---I know you have a lot of livestock---will remain behind in the towns that I have assigned to you.
20
Help the other Israelites until they occupy the land that the LORD is giving them west of the Jordan and until the LORD lets them live there in peace, as he has already done here for you. After that, you may return to this land that I have assigned to you.'
Joshua 4:12
The men of the tribes of Reuben and Gad and of half the tribe of Manasseh, ready for battle, crossed ahead of the rest of the people, as Moses had told them to do.
Joshua 4:13
In the presence of the LORD about forty thousand men ready for war crossed over to the plain near Jericho.
